> How will I know if my kernel is to big for a zImage? The build will complain at the end. Then you just have to type 'make bzImage'. > Reason for asking .... > > I can't get my kernel to compile at all and when I try to compile useing > "make zImage" I get the following message, about 3 minutes into compile.: > cpp: output pipe has been closed > gcc: Internal compiler error: program cc1 got fatal signal 11 [snip] > now when I just hit up-arrow and then enter aggin it will start over and > skip what it has already compiled and go on for awhile (this amount of > time varrys) but it will always come back and quit with this same error. This is a hardware error (bad memory, bad cache or something else)... Phil. -- TO UNSUBSCRIBE FROM THIS MAILING LIST: e-mail the word "unsubscribe" to [EMAIL PROTECTED] .
